Getting to MSP

Metro Blue Line light rail runs from downtown Minneapolis (Warehouse District/Hennepin station) to T1-Lindbergh in 25–28 minutes ($2.50). The line also connects the Mall of America (Bloomington) in 13 minutes to the same station. T2-Humphrey (primarily Sun Country and charter flights) requires a free shuttle from T1 or a direct Blue Line stop at the Terminal 2-Humphrey station.Taxis and ride-hails from downtown Minneapolis cost $25–40 and take 15–30 minutes. The airport is conveniently close to both downtowns; St. Paul is 10–15 minutes by car.

Flight time is about 2 hours 30 minutes to 2 hours 50 minutes westbound and 2 hours 10 minutes to 2 hours 30 minutes eastbound. The distance is roughly 1,300 km. Westbound flights fight headwinds from the jet stream, especially in winter.
Delta Air Lines operates nonstop service from its Minneapolis-St. Paul hub. Sun Country Airlines has also served this route. Frequency is typically 1 to 2 daily nonstops on Delta. Equipment is usually a regional jet like the CRJ-900 or E175 operated by SkyWest or Endeavor Air under the Delta Connection brand.
Billings Logan is Montana's busiest airport. It has a single terminal with two concourses. The airport sits on a rimrock bluff above the city, about 3 km from downtown. Car rental counters are in the terminal. Taxis and rideshare are available but limited compared to larger airports.
MSP is Delta's second-largest hub and connects Billings to the Eastern U.S., Midwest, and international destinations. Connection times at MSP run 60 to 90 minutes for domestic transfers. The airport has two terminals (Lindbergh and Humphrey) but Delta operates entirely from Terminal 1 Lindbergh, so connections stay in one building.
Summer brings peak demand for Billings as a gateway to Yellowstone National Park (170 km southwest), the Beartooth Highway, and Little Bighorn Battlefield. Winter weather can cause delays at both airports. MSP is well-equipped for winter operations but blizzard conditions occasionally close the airport. Spring and fall have lower fares and lighter loads.
